Motorcycle ambulances are a type of emergency vehicle which either carries a solo paramedic or first responder to a patient; or is used with a trailer or sidecar for transporting patients. A motorcycle ambulance is able to respond to a medical emergency much faster than a car or van in heavy traffic,[1][2][3] which can increase survival rates for patients suffering cardiac arrest.[4][5]

Since 2000, the São Paulo Fire Department has operated Honda motorcycle ambulances (Portuguese: Motos Operacionais de Bombeiros, known as "MOBs") in a first responder role, to offset the influence of traffic on the response times of traditional ambulances. The motorcycles carry a variety of emergency care equipment (including basic extrication, technical rescue, and firefighting gear) and are always deployed in two-man teams, with the lead vehicle carrying a first aid kit and intravenous fluids and the rear vehicle carrying more advanced equipment, including an automated external defibrillator, suction devices, and emergency delivery kits.[6][7]
Fire departments in other states, such as Minas Gerais, Mato Grosso do Sul and Pernambuco, have also adopted motorcycle ambulances since 2008.[8][9][10] In August 2008, SAMU, the federal emergency medical services, purchased 400 motorcycle ambulances to be deployed nationwide between December 2008 and 2009.[11]
According to the book Rescue Mission which is written by an Emergency Medical Assistant of Hong Kong Fire Services Department, the H.K.F.S.D. established the first motorcycle programme in 1982.[12] At first, there are only two motorcycles stationed in Morrison Hill Ambulance Depot. In 1986, the H.K.F.S.D. found that motorcycles are useful for responding medical calls, so they bought seven more motorcycles in 1987. In 1989, the motorcycle team had 15 motorcycles and stationed in several ambulance depots. Today, the H.K.F.S.D. has 35 motorcycles.[13]
Auxiliary Medical Service, another government-owned service, also has motorcycles.
In some areas of Japan. Japanese fire departments use off-road motorcycles as emergency vehicles. They are useful for negotiating the small streets and heavy traffic in the large urban areas of Japanese cities. Having off-road motorcycles helps in responding to the mountain hills that are around a lot of cities. Some departments would likely have their crews in teams of two or three motorcycles. One of the motorcycles carries a first aid kit and/or automated external defibrillator. The other motorcycles in this team may carry fire fighting and rescue equipment. Most crews are firefighters with training in first responder, First Aid, and/or paramedic. Each crew member wears a light weight fire suit and a fire fighting motorcycle helmet. A lot of these motorcycles have their own radio, cargo bays, lights and sirens.
As part of the United Kingdom's Department for International Development (DFID) wider £50 million country programme (2009), they are putting in place among other things a new motorcycle ambulance service. The Magunga's Health Centre now operates a motorcycle (sidecar) ambulance service.[14][15]

They have been used in remote rural areas in Malawi[17][18] as a means to improve access to obstetric health care facilities for women in labor or needing prenatal care. Lightweight off-road motorcycles, equipped with a sidecar holding a stretcher for the patient, have been found to be an efficient supplement, but not replacement for, 4-wheel drive SUV ambulances. Purchase prices and operating costs have been found to be a fraction of a four-wheeled vehicle, and the sidecar rigs have been found to be less likely to be misused by diverting them for non-healthcare purposes. The lighter sidecar rigs are better able to cope with poor roads and areas that become impassible to heavier cars and trucks during the rainy season. Disadvantages include the reluctance of drivers to travel at night in some cases, and the inability to carry more than one patient at a time.
The report concluded that:
| “ | Motorcycle ambulances reduce the delay in referring women with obstetric complications from remote rural health centers to the district hospital, particularly under circumstances where health centers have no access to other transport or means of communication to call for an ambulance. They are also a relatively cheap and effective option for referral of patients in developing countries, particularly in rural areas with little or no public transport. Nineteen motorcycle ambulances can be bought for the price of one Toyota land cruiser car ambulance. Operating costs compare in a similar way. Motorcycle ambulances also potentially help reduce costs for women and their families to access EmOC, although this was not the subject of this study.[19] | ” |
In March 2009, through a partnership between UNICEF and the Government of Southern Sudan, a lifeline was extended to some pregnant women with the introduction of five motorcycle ambulances in the state of Eastern Equatoria.[20][21][22]
The UNICEF Annual Report 2009 concluded that:
| “ | The benefits for women in Southern Sudan are already apparent. No deaths were reported among the more than 170 pregnant women who used the service in 2009. Community support has contributed to the success of the initiative. The telephone number to access the service has been posted on trees, broadcast on the radio and announced in churches. People offer their phones to call the ambulances. In some cases, neighbours help carry the pregnant woman to the nearest pickup spot when a motorcycle cannot reach the woman’s home. The special motorcycles are also being used to assist children and adults in need of medical attention.[23] | ” |
Since the start of the UNICEF pilot study additional motorcycle ambulances have been delivered to the region using a Not On Our Watch Awards Grant to U.S. Fund for UNICEF with the aim of Reducing Maternal Mortality Rates in Southern Sudan.[24]
Emergency Medical Service in Belgrade has introduced a Suzuki V-Strom 650 in 2011. The crew consists of a motorcycle driver and a doctor. The three bags is the equipment for CPR, bandaging, anti-shock therapy, paramedic and other equipment.
Motorcycles are used as rapid response vehicles by NHS emergency medical services and St John Ambulance in the United Kingdom.[25][26]
St John Ambulance Wales have introduced three motorbikes after a successful trial.[citation needed] With a Honda Transalp based in Newtown, a BMW R1200RT based in the centre of Cardiff, along with a BMW F650 which covers the South Wales Area. The bikes will be used primarily as an initial response at road races, cycle races and other major events where it would be difficult to move ambulances through crowds. The bikes have been used at the Cardiff Half Marathon, the 2010 Tour of Britain Cycle Race, the Ryder Cup.
The Bavarian Red Cross has operated motorcycle ambulances since 1983. As of 2011 they report a fleet of 25 motorcycles and 100 volunteer paramedics.[27]
Austin County and Travis County EMS of Austin, Texas is using a fleet of four BMW G650 X-Ps[clarification needed] to supplement the standard ambulance response. Currently the motorcycles are deployed only for special events and times of unusually high traffic congestion, but plans are for them to become a regular system resource in the near future.[28][29]
Honda, BMW, and Yamaha motorcycles are common models used in many countries and departments. A number of manufacturers produce sidecars for motorcycles and scooters. Active motorcycle ambulance manufacturers include The Ranger Production Company,[30][31] and Riders for Health, a charity which manufactures the Uhuru in Zimbabwe.[32]
Motorcycle ambulances were used during World War I by the British, French and Americans. At the time the advantages of light weight, speed, and mobility over larger vehicles was cited as the motive for the use of sidedcar rigs in this role. The US version had two stretchers arranged one on top of the other.[33][34][35] The French ambulance used a sidecar that held a single patient, who could either lie down or sit up.[36]
The British Red Cross Society used an 8 bhp (6 kW) NUT motorcycle with a double decker sidecar like the US version. During testing it needed only a 9 ft (2.7 m) turning area, versus 35 ft (11 m) for a motor car ambulance, and had a lower fuel consumption of 55–65 mpg-US (4.3–3.6 L/100 km), compared with 12–17 mpg-US (20–14 L/100 km) for car ambulances. Due to lighter weight they were said to be less likely to get stuck and could be pushed out more easily than a large vehicle.[37]
Sidecar ambulances were used in Redondo Beach, California in 1915, stationed at a bath house at a beach resort to reach drowning victims quickly. Prior to using the motorcycle, life guards had to run or row up to several miles along the beach to respond to calls.[38] The Knightsbright Animal Hospital and Institute, London, was using a sidecar ambulance to transport dogs in 1912, and this mode was still in use in 1937 by the Maryland Humane Society.[39][40]
